Are you guys riding the "Group rides" as Cat A/B/womens (C) or the shorter "Races" split into Cat A/B/C/D?

I'm nowhere near strong enough for what is usually considered Cat A/B (averaging 2.1W/kg on Stage 1's Cat D race damn near killed me) but the companion app says that the longer group rides are between 1-5W/kg regardless of rider category.
We're riding the Group rides in "Cat A". And yes, although the "Races" are split into CATS A-D based on your w/kg, the Categories in the group rides simply mean: A- long route; B - short route; C - women only. Anyone of any w/kg can ride the group rides (because in theory they're not a race*)

*but we all know they kind of are really!
